1

Why Hiring Professional deck contractors Can Reinvent Your Backyard Oasis

News Discuss 
Your Guide to Reliable Roof Covering Providers: From Setups to Replacements Reliable roof solutions are crucial for house owners looking for to shield their financial investments. Understanding the various roof materials and the value of professional examinations can considerably impact the longevity of a roofing. When to repair or replace https://connerwrfyr.blog2freedom.com/36288144/when-to-call-a-roof-replacement-contractor-atlanta-before-it-s-too-late

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story